Lisa Surowsky was asked to help in determining the bestordering policy for a new product. Currently, the demand forthe new product has been projected to be about 1,000 unitsannually. To get a handle on the carrying and ordering costs,Lisa prepared a series of average inventory costs. Lisathought that these costs would be appropriate for the newproduct. The results are summarized in the followingtable. These data were compiled for 10,000 inventory itemsthat were carried or held during the year and were ordered 100times during the past year. Help Lisa determine theEOQ.
CostFactor Cost($)
Taxes 2,000
Processing andInspection 1,500
New productdevelopment 2,500
Billpaying 500
Orderingsupplies 50
Inventoryinsurance 600
Productadvertising 800
Spoilage 750
Sending purchasingorders 800
Inventoryinquiries 450
Warehousesupplies 280
Research anddevelopment 2,750
Purchasesalaries 3,000
Warehousesalaries 2,800
Inventorytheft 800
Purchase ordersupplies 500
Inventoryobsolescence 300
